Light-scattering by optically soft randomly oriented spheroids
Authors:Nikolay V Shepelevich  Inna V Prostakova and Valery N Lopatin

Abstract:In the framework of the Rayleigh–Gans–Debye approximation and anomalous diffraction approaches, the light scattering characteristics of randomly oriented spheroids have been investigated. It has been proved that the system of randomly oriented spheroids is equivalent to the system of polydisperse spherical particles that have the same values of volume and surface area as nonspherical particles. The power law size distribution meeting these requirements has been obtained.
Keywords:Optically soft particles  Light-scattering intensity  Approximations
